In days gone by when there were several priests in a parish and many seminarians it was custom to hold a parish census every five years. The priests and seminarians would visit each household in the parish and update records and also find ministry needs such as shut-ins needing communion, rides needed for church, individuals wishing to become Catholic, new families needing to be registered, etc. I am the only priest here as you know and there are no seminarians available for the task. Have you any wisdom as to how we could undertake such a task? Please feel free to share in writing and place in the collection basket, send an e-mail, or call the parish office.
